The massive rains we got last week (7+ inches) flooded my coop. I live on a hill. The roof of run runs off back of coop. Back of coop also caught water from further up the hill. I had about 3 inches of water in coop. So, I ran a 1 inch pvc pipe in front to drain water. Then I dug a trench along back side of coop, got a 10 ft pvc drain pipe with holes in half of it. I laid it in trench, covered it with river rock. My HOPE is that water coming down the hill and off the roof will go into drain and divert around end of coop.
We will see....
